>> I wonder if I hit a bug in src/Wt/WPainter.C:
>>
>> void WPainter::drawPoint(double x, double y)
>> {
>>  drawLine(x - 0.05, y - 0.05, x + 0.05, y + 0.05);
>> }
>>
>> With pixel offset 0.05 to each side no full pixel is drawn. Draw a
>> rectangle with drawPoint() and you will see that it doesn't paint the
>> canvas with the specified color (I only tried it with HtmlCanvas). It
>> will never reach full intensity of either of the RGB colors: black
>> turns grey, red becomes a mix of red and white and so on...
>>
>> If the pixel offsets are set to 0.5 everything works just fine,
>> because then each point has the size of one pixel (no gaps in
>> between). If you agree with the fix, could you apply it to the git
>> tree?

It's just a one line patch:

-drawLine(x - 0.05, y - 0.05, x + 0.05, y + 0.05);
+drawLine(x - 0.5, y - 0.5, x + 0.5, y + 0.5);
